About Muguo Li
Muguo Li is a scholar working on Control and Systems Engineering, Computer Vision and Pattern Recognition, Computer Networks and Communications, Civil and Structural Engineering and Ocean Engineering, having authored 36 papers that have together received 378 indexed citations. Recurring topics across this work include Stability and Control of Uncertain Systems (9 papers), Adaptive Control of Nonlinear Systems (9 papers), Neural Networks Stability and Synchronization (8 papers), Advanced Vision and Imaging (5 papers), Optical measurement and interference techniques (4 papers), Underwater Vehicles and Communication Systems (4 papers), Image Processing Techniques and Applications (4 papers) and Geotechnical Engineering and Underground Structures (4 papers). The work is most often cited by research in Control and Systems Engineering (244 citations), Computer Networks and Communications (150 citations), Computer Vision and Pattern Recognition (62 citations), Media Technology (22 citations) and Earth-Surface Processes (12 citations). Muguo Li has collaborated with scholars based in China. Frequent co-authors include Da Liu, Juan Meng, Qun Zhang, Xinyue He, Hongqi Yang, Jing Wang, Shuxue Liu, Lei Wang, Qun Zhang and Da Liu. Their work appears in journals such as ISA Transactions, Journal of the Franklin Institute, Measurement, China Ocean Engineering and Advances in Engineering Software.
